1. Singapore F1 Grand Prix Dates
The 2026 Singapore F1 Grand Prix is scheduled for October 09-11, 2026, running for three thrilling days!

The races will unfold at the iconic Marina Bay Street Circuit, right near Marina Bay. It's the perfect setup to combine the excitement of the F1 Grand Prix with an unforgettable Singapore vacation!

If seeing F1 live has been a dream of yours, like it has been for me, I highly recommend checking out this Singapore race. Many other F1 events are typically held in the Americas or Europe, making flights and travel time quite a commitment for those traveling from Asia or Oceania. Singapore offers a fantastic, accessible alternative!

Why is this such a great deal, you ask? During the F1 period, fan turnout is massive, driving accommodation prices sky-high. For example, Marina Bay Sands currently has no availability, and hotels like Swissôtel, Parkroyal, and Fairmont are going for around ~$1,380 per night. Even the Pullman is around ~$1,242 per night – quite a hefty sum!


Lauras is a 5-star hotel that opened in 2025, located on Sentosa Island. This makes it perfect for exploring other attractions like Universal Studios and the S.E.A. Aquarium! Based on the package dates, the same room type, and breakfast included, a single night at Lauras would typically cost around ~$1,132, making a 3-night stay nearly ~$3,396 for just the hotel. After enjoying a day at the races, you'll want to explore the rest of Singapore, right? Here are some places you can book using your KKDAY voucher!

Gardens by the Bay is a must-visit when you're in Singapore! You can visit for approximately $7.80 USD.
> Check Gardens by the Bay Tickets

If you love theme parks, Universal Studios Singapore on Sentosa Island is a fantastic choice! It's enjoyable even on a rainy day. Tickets are approximately $60 USD. (The S.E.A. Aquarium, also on Sentosa Island, is around $22 USD).
> Check Universal Studios Tickets
> Check S.E.A. Aquarium Tickets
Oh, and for family travelers, many people enjoy the Night Safari with a Singapore Mandai Multi-Park Pass! This one is around $70 USD.

And of course, you can't miss the Singapore landmark with its boat-shaped building: the Marina Bay Sands SkyPark Observation Deck! You can go up for approximately $27 USD per person, or if you're a guest at Marina Bay Sands, it's free!
